Legislative Branch
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| Senate | 100 seats, 6 year term, Pres. Pro Tempore, V.P |
| House Of Representatives | 435 seats, 2 year term, Speaker of the House |
| Bicameral Legislature | Consisting of two houses, as in the law-making body |
| Apportioned | To be distributed, as in the seats of the House of Representatives |
| Gerrymandering | The process of drawing congressional district lines to favor a political party |
| Expulsion | The removal of a person from an institution, such as Congress, for serious misconduct |
| Censure | The formal disapproval of the actions of a member of Congress by the others |
| Sessions | Meetings of Congress |
| Caucus | Meetings of party leader to determine party policy or to choose the party's candidates for the public office |
| President Pro Tempore | The official who presides over the Senate in the Vice President's absence |
| Speaker of the House | The presiding officer of the House of Representatives |
| Implied Powers | Powers not specifically granted to Congress by the U.S Constitution that are suggested to necessary to carry out the powers delegated to Congress under the Constitution |
| Impeach | To charge a government official with misconduct. |
